PEE PEL SEE SEL

ESLS

EFLF

Duration d

PEE = Preceding Event EarliestPEL = Preceding Event LatestES = Earliest Start LS = Latest Start

SEE = Succeeding Event EarliestSEL = Succeeding Event LatestEF = Earliest FinishLF = Latest Finish
